RELX × Doctrine

Global information provider RELX announced on September 3, 2026, that it had finalized the acquisition of Doctrine, a French legal AI platform. [13] Doctrine will be integrated into RELX's LexisNexis division, combining its AI capabilities with the established legal data provider's portfolio. [13]

The asset

A French legal intelligence and artificial intelligence platform used by law firms, corporate legal departments, and government entities. [13]

Personal data
The acquisition raises questions for clients regarding control and processing of data entrusted to the platform, which is governed by the original client contract and GDPR. [13]

What it means if you hold data

This deal exemplifies the consolidation trend where major legal information providers acquire AI-native startups to absorb their technology and curated data corpora. It underscores that a platform's value is not just its software, but the underlying, structured dataset and the AI models trained on it. [13]
